Super Mario Run is a really simple game, until you try to complete all if the extra coin challenges—all of a sudden those easy levels become tough when you’re trying to get all the pink, purple, or black coins instead of just running through.

If you miss a jump early in the level, you’ve got to do the whole thing over again, which means you need to die three times to start from the beginning of the level. Or, if you want to do it the easier way, there is an option to restart the level—it’s just a little hidden.

First, tap the Pause button. And then tap Retry. Did you already know it was there? I didn’t notice it until after my first playthrough.

You’ll be asked to confirm, and then the level will restart.
